Joshua laughs off Parker’s ‘king of steroids’ claim

 

Anthony Joshua has laughed off claims of drug use after Joseph Parker dubbed him the “king of steroids”.
Joshua and Parker will fight at Cardiff’s Principality Stadium on 31 March, the first time in history that two reigning heavyweight world champions have met in Britain.
Joshua, 28, holds the IBF and WBA belts, while New Zealander Parker is the WBO champion.
“I’ve heard so much in trash talk that nothing’s new anymore,” he said.
“I know my records are clean, that’s why I don’t bite at it.”
He added: “Trash talk has a place in boxing if it’s natural but you shouldn’t use it as a tool to sell the fight. I would never put on an act to sell a fight.”
Parker made the claim in an interview with a New Zealand radio station after the fight was confirmed on Sunday.
